This webcast showcases our latest research on sales readiness and sales enablement practices in 123 business-to-business firms, directly employing more than 70,000 salespeople. It finds just 43% of firms improved sales organization effectiveness over the prior 12 months, and fewer than one in five (18%) consider their salesperson training and development efforts effective.
More remarkably, our research shows a widening gap between effective sales organizations, who demonstrate the greatest degree of improvement, and ineffective sales organizations, whose rates of improvement are 79% lower than those of effective firms'.
